92,000 on my 2010 Q5, and I guess living on borrowed time because it has been trouble free for it's whole life, save for DRLs and the plastic water pump issues. The air bag light came on and my dealer says the driver's seat belt tensioner needs replacement, and it's not a recall subject. I didn't see any posts about this and am just wondering. Thanks

From my 35 years of new and used Audi's, I have never come across a special warranty from them covering seat belts.
For OP, I'm guessing this must have to do with the pyrotechnic feature of the belt that would tighten it in an accident. The rest of the belt would just be mechanical and not monitored electronically. From other airbag light experience on various Audis, I would simply check the connector involved for the relevant part before replacing it. Not uncommon to just have a bit of corrosion at a small terminal plug and simple unplugging and replugging of the connector can fix the error. As usual, disconnect the battery before fooling with any part of this system if you go DIY.
